Chief public defender delays departure
Expect to see David E. Cook’s face at the Marion County Public Defender Agency a little longer than anticipated.The chief public defender is delaying for a month his departure – originally planned for Feb. 15 – to help make sure the agency has adequate leadership while its board of directors searches for a successor. Cook is stepping down after 12 years as the county’s top public defender to work for immigration firm Gresk & Singleton in Indianapolis.Because the agency needed leadership…
